当前位置: 首页 > session

     session
         8955人感兴趣  ●  2641次引用
  • PHP框架怎么进行接口调试_PHP框架API调试工具与日志分析

    PHP框架怎么进行接口调试_PHP框架API调试工具与日志分析

    使用调试工具、日志记录和断点调试可高效定位PHP接口问题。1.LaravelTelescope、Symfony调试条、Postman和Swagger用于实时监控与测试接口;2.开启调试模式并记录请求响应日志,通过中间件和Monolog分类追踪;3.配合Xdebug在IDE中设置断点,逐步分析执行流程;4.生产环境关闭调试并脱敏日志,防止敏感信息泄露。合理组合工具与策略,提升开发效率与系统安全性。

    php教程 2172025-10-20 11:30:02

  • phpcms授权怎么实现?OAuth授权如何配置使用?

    phpcms授权怎么实现?OAuth授权如何配置使用?

    PHPCMS本身不内置OAuth机制,但可通过扩展实现第三方登录。首先基于其member模块构建本地账号体系,再通过引入SDK或手动实现OAuth2流程,完成与微信、QQ等平台的授权对接。具体步骤包括:在开放平台注册应用获取AppID与AppSecret,配置回调地址如http://yourdomain/index.php?m=member&c=oauth&a=callback&platform=qq,在PHPCMS的/phpcms/modules/member/下创建oauth.php控制器,

    PHPCMS 5242025-10-20 11:17:01

  • 如何在mysql中使用事务保证多条SQL一致性

    如何在mysql中使用事务保证多条SQL一致性

    开启事务可确保多条SQL操作的原子性,通过STARTTRANSACTION、COMMIT和ROLLBACK控制流程,在转账等场景中保证数据一致性。

    mysql教程 3452025-10-20 11:14:01

  • Drools FileSystemResource:文件锁定与资源管理深度解析

    Drools FileSystemResource:文件锁定与资源管理深度解析

    本文探讨了Drools7.73.0中FileSystemResource在加载KJAR文件时可能遇到的文件锁定问题。尽管用户报告通过文件路径创建的资源在addKieModule后无法释放,导致文件无法删除,但Drools官方团队未能复现此问题。文章将分析该场景、提供示例代码,并建议在遇到类似问题时,可考虑使用输入流方式或向官方提交详细复现报告。

    java教程 4822025-10-20 11:03:05

  • edge浏览器怎么设置启动时恢复上次会话_edge浏览器启动恢复上次会话设置方法

    edge浏览器怎么设置启动时恢复上次会话_edge浏览器启动恢复上次会话设置方法

    首先选择“继续上次会话”设置或添加“--restore-last-session”命令行参数,再通过组策略配置启动行为,三步实现Edge浏览器自动恢复标签页。

    浏览器 4962025-10-20 11:03:01

  • ThinkPHP框架怎么使用Session_ThinkPHP会话管理与安全配置方法

    ThinkPHP框架怎么使用Session_ThinkPHP会话管理与安全配置方法

    ThinkPHP通过内置Session机制实现用户状态保持,支持file、redis等存储驱动,默认自动开启Session;使用session()函数进行设置、获取、删除操作;可通过config/session.php配置type、prefix、expire、httponly、secure等参数;推荐高并发场景使用Redis存储以提升性能;安全方面建议启用httponly和secure、设置合理过期时间、避免存储敏感信息,并在登录后调用session_reset()防止会话固定攻击。

    php教程 7022025-10-20 10:57:02

  • Laravel 中限制用户从不同店铺向购物车添加商品

    Laravel 中限制用户从不同店铺向购物车添加商品

    本文旨在提供在Laravel框架中,如何限制用户将来自不同sponsor_id(店铺)的商品添加到同一个购物车会话中的方法。我们将探讨两种实现方案:一种是循环检查购物车中已存在的商品,另一种是将商品按sponsor_id分组存储在不同的购物车中。

    php教程 2902025-10-20 10:52:01

  • 深入理解 Laravel Session::put:避免常见陷阱与实现表单限流

    深入理解 Laravel Session::put:避免常见陷阱与实现表单限流

    本文旨在深入探讨Laravel框架中Session::put方法的正确用法及其常见误区。针对用户在实现表单提交限流时遇到的问题,详细阐述了Session::put必须提供键值对的原理,并提供了如何在控制器中利用会话机制有效防止重复提交的实战代码示例。通过本文,读者将掌握Laravel会话管理的关键技巧,确保应用逻辑的准确执行。

    php教程 3232025-10-20 10:47:01

  • 解决EC2上PHP应用表单提交来源验证失败问题:HTTPS迁移策略

    解决EC2上PHP应用表单提交来源验证失败问题:HTTPS迁移策略

    本文旨在解决将PHPZend应用迁移至AWSEC2时,登录表单提交出现“Theformsubmitteddidnotoriginatefromtheexpectedsite”错误。该问题通常源于CSRF保护机制对协议或源站的验证失败,核心解决方案是将应用从HTTP切换至HTTPS,并确保服务器及应用配置正确识别HTTPS协议,从而保障表单提交的安全性与一致性。

    php教程 4062025-10-20 10:41:01

  • 识别Instagram用户页面不存在情况:突破200状态码的限制

    识别Instagram用户页面不存在情况:突破200状态码的限制

    当通过编程方式检查Instagram用户资料页时,即使页面不存在,Instagram也可能返回HTTP200状态码,导致传统的状态码判断失效。本教程将介绍如何通过分析响应内容(如HTML文本)来准确识别“页面不可用”的情况,从而实现对Instagram资料页存在性的可靠验证。

    Python教程 8062025-10-20 10:38:01

  • Laravel Livewire 动态表单数据存储:固定与多行数据合并入库实践

    Laravel Livewire 动态表单数据存储:固定与多行数据合并入库实践

    本教程探讨在LaravelLivewire中如何高效处理动态表单数据存储。当需要将用户选择的固定信息(如教师、学年、学期)与多行动态输入的排课信息(如课程描述、时间、日期、教室)合并并批量写入数据库时,关键在于在循环内部为每条动态数据创建新的模型实例,并巧妙地合并固定与动态数据,确保数据准确持久化。

    php教程 6142025-10-20 10:30:09

  • Instagram页面存在性检测:200状态码下的“页面不可用”识别方法

    Instagram页面存在性检测:200状态码下的“页面不可用”识别方法

    当通过编程方式检查Instagram个人资料页面的存在性时,一个常见挑战是即使页面不存在,Instagram服务器也可能返回HTTP200状态码。本教程将介绍一种有效的解决方案,通过分析HTTP响应的文本内容来精确识别“页面不可用”的情况,从而避免仅依赖状态码判断的误区,确保代码能够准确区分有效与无效的Instagram页面。

    Python教程 2602025-10-20 10:26:34

  • Go TCP客户端数据发送延迟问题解析与调试

    Go TCP客户端数据发送延迟问题解析与调试

    本文探讨Go语言TCP客户端在使用SetNoDelay(true)后,数据仍未能即时发送的问题。核心在于理解Nagle算法与TCP缓冲机制,并强调通过构建一个简单的本地回显服务器来验证客户端行为的重要性。教程将提供一个Go语言实现的测试服务器,帮助开发者诊断客户端数据发送延迟的根本原因,确保数据按预期即时传输。

    Golang 3552025-10-20 10:20:27

  • Laravel Session::put 正确用法与基于会话的请求限流实现

    Laravel Session::put 正确用法与基于会话的请求限流实现

    本文探讨了Laravel5.8中Session::put方法在实现请求限流时遇到的常见问题,指出其正确用法需指定键值对,并展示了如何结合时间戳实现基于会话的2小时请求间隔限制。通过理解Session::put和Session::get的工作原理,开发者可以有效地控制用户表单提交频率,避免重复操作,提升应用健壮性。

    php教程 7342025-10-20 09:50:39

  • PHP表单提交与页面重定向后的状态管理:解决$_POST数据丢失问题

    PHP表单提交与页面重定向后的状态管理:解决$_POST数据丢失问题

    当PHP表单提交到处理脚本并重定向回原页面时,`$_POST`数据会因HTTP重定向机制而丢失,导致无法正确判断并显示提交后的状态。本教程将详细阐述这一常见问题的原因,并提供利用PHP会话(`$_SESSION`)机制的解决方案。通过在处理脚本中保存必要的状态信息,我们可以在重定向后的页面中正确判断并展示提交结果或确认消息,从而优化用户体验。

    html教程 4022025-10-20 09:40:32

  • 解决EC2上PHP应用表单提交“非预期来源”错误:HTTPS协议配置指南

    解决EC2上PHP应用表单提交“非预期来源”错误:HTTPS协议配置指南

    在将PHPZend应用迁移至AWSEC2后,用户常遇到“Theformsubmitteddidnotoriginatefromtheexpectedsite”错误,尤其在登录时。此问题通常与跨站请求伪造(CSRF)保护机制对请求来源的验证失败有关。本文将深入分析其原因,并提供通过强制使用HTTPS协议来有效解决此问题的专业指南。

    php教程 7192025-10-20 09:40:02

关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号